Personal Independence Payment (PIP) is a topic we have covered extensively over the last year in order to encourage more people to access additional financial support they may be eligible to claim. PIP is a benefit paid by the Department for Work and Pensions (DWP) to people who may need help with daily living activities or getting around outside the home because of a long-term illness, disability or mental health condition.

State Pension provides essential financial support every month for around 12.6 million people across the UK, including 981,399 Scots. This regular payment is available for those who have reached the UK Government’s eligible retirement age, which increased to 66 for both men and women in October, 2020.
Personal Independence Payment (PIP) is a tax-free, non-means tested benefit for people over the age of 16 who have a physical or mental disability and need help taking part in everyday life, or have difficulty getting around outside the home. PIP replaced Disability Living Allowance (DLA) for people aged 16 or over in 2013 and anyone still receiving this benefit will eventually be asked to make a claim for PIP instead.
State Pension age is regularly reviewed to make sure that it is affordable and fair as people are living longer and spending a greater proportion of their adult life in retirement than in the past. The Department for Work and Pensions (DWP) said that "when the State Pension was introduced in 1948, a 65-year-old could expect to spend 13.5 years receiving the benefit, around 23 per cent of their adult life".
